What 36.4 g/dL means

An MCHC of 36.4 g/dL is at or just above the top of the typical adult range of 32–36 g/dL. Small overshoots like this are common and often not meaningful.

There is a physical ceiling to how much hemoglobin a red cell can hold, so MCHC rarely climbs much above 36 for real reasons. A reading in this zone most often reflects ordinary measurement variation or a sample effect, such as fatty blood after a recent meal. Occasionally it is an early clue to hereditary spherocytosis, a usually mild inherited condition where red cells are rounder and more concentrated than normal.

Most US labs consider roughly 32 to 36 g/dL normal for adult MCHC, following the convention cited by MedlinePlus, though your lab's printed range may differ slightly. There is no standard 'panic' cutoff for MCHC itself — with very abnormal values, the accompanying hemoglobin determines true urgency.

Common causes

  • Normal analyzer and lab-to-lab variation
  • A lipemic sample — high fat levels in the blood after a fatty meal or with high triglycerides
  • Slight red-cell damage (hemolysis) during a difficult blood draw
  • Mild or early hereditary spherocytosis
  • A recent blood transfusion

Sensible next steps

  1. In most cases this simply gets rechecked on your next routine CBC — ideally after fasting, in case blood fats skewed the sample
  2. Compare with older results; a one-time blip matters less than a persistent elevation
  3. Mention any family history of anemia, jaundice, gallstones at a young age, or spleen removal, which can point toward hereditary spherocytosis
  4. Discuss the result with your clinician at a routine visit to decide whether anything beyond a recheck is needed

What does a low MCHC mean?

A low MCHC means your red blood cells contain a lower-than-normal concentration of hemoglobin, making them look pale under a microscope — doctors call this hypochromia. The most common cause by far is iron deficiency; inherited conditions such as thalassemia trait and long-term inflammation are other frequent explanations. Your clinician will read it alongside hemoglobin, MCV, and often iron studies to pin down the cause.

Can diet or iron pills fix a low MCHC?

Only if low iron is actually the cause — and that's a real 'if.' When iron deficiency is confirmed, iron-rich foods and supplements prescribed by your clinician usually normalize MCHC over a few months. But if the cause is thalassemia trait, extra iron won't help and can even be harmful, and if the iron deficiency comes from hidden blood loss, the bleeding source needs finding. Get iron studies done before starting supplements, and take them under a clinician's guidance.

What is the difference between MCHC, MCH, and hemoglobin?

Hemoglobin is the total amount of the oxygen-carrying protein in your blood — the headline anemia number. MCH is the average amount (weight) of hemoglobin inside a single red cell, while MCHC is the average concentration — how tightly that hemoglobin is packed relative to the cell's size. Two people can have identical hemoglobin but different MCHC values if their red cells differ in size and density, which is exactly why doctors use these indices to sort out what type of anemia is present.
